Output 90590496d12e011f0d7fa006b5a2d2dd05ec8fc5feb421a258b1160b5a98bda8:4

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abf14e06430578ba88604e378654419d5142920d5b6c869041dfc69713b338d9
address
tb1p40c5upjrq4ut4zrqfcmcv4zpn4g59ysdtdkgdyzpmlrfwyan8rvscyjq8a
transaction
90590496d12e011f0d7fa006b5a2d2dd05ec8fc5feb421a258b1160b5a98bda8